How Do You Introduce a Cat to Nail Trimming?

The Cashmere Comb large-cat grooming set arranged in a studio view.

Direct answer: begin with brief paw touches when the cat is relaxed, reward calm behaviour and progress slowly to a single nail if appropriate. There is no need to finish every paw in one sitting.

Learn the anatomy first

Ask a vet nurse or groomer to show you the claw and sensitive quick. Use clean, sharp clippers intended for pets and good lighting.

Keep restraint minimal

Support the cat securely without pinning or chasing. Stop if they tense, pull away or become distressed.

Know when not to continue

Overgrown, split, bleeding or painful claws need professional attention. Scratching furniture does not necessarily keep every nail at a safe length.
